Transaction 43b141672660e4b15cf8a8eb2556734d9cf3869500503c472243fa5c2cac596e

1 Input
2 Outputs
  • 43b141672660e4b15cf8a8eb2556734d9cf3869500503c472243fa5c2cac596e:0
  • value  329933
    address  3MtV1y8EL9YCZrcxwhku2Dk8UY7qnu1CrQ
  • 43b141672660e4b15cf8a8eb2556734d9cf3869500503c472243fa5c2cac596e:1
  • value  2541535
    address  3Ku8oqbF37yMLuaLF1o5yWsg1jHcWTr6SF